Fairfield by Marriott Jaipur is proud to announce the appointment of Chef Deepak Rawat as the new Head Chef. With a remarkable culinary journey of over 15 years across leading hospitality brands in India and Thailand, Chef Rawat brings with him a deep mastery of Indian cuisine, tandoor, and global culinary techniques.
Before joining Fairfield Jaipur, Chef Rawat served as Sous Chef at IHCL in Haridwar and held key leadership positions at Fairfield by Marriott Indore, Anantara Chiang Mai, and The Westin Grande Sukhumvit in Bangkok.
He also played a significant role in setting up Indian kitchens abroad, notably at Aviyana Hotel in Thailand, showcasing his versatility and global sensibility.
Chef Rawat’s return to the Marriott family signals Fairfield Jaipur’s commitment to delivering exceptional dining experiences infused with authentic Indian flavours and modern creativity.
“We are delighted to welcome Chef Deepak Rawat back to the Marriott family in this pivotal leadership role,” said Rishabh Jain, Hotel Manager, Fairfield by Marriott Jaipur. “His experience, creativity, and passion for Indian cuisine will undoubtedly create memorable dining moments for our guests.”

Holiday Inn New Delhi Mayur Vihar Noida has announced the appointment of Himanshu Sahni as Director of Catering Sales. With more than 14 years of experience in luxury hospitality, Himanshu brings proven expertise in MICE sales and client relationship management.
His professional journey includes leadership roles at Roseate Hotels & Resorts, The Suryaa New Delhi, and Eros Hotel Nehru Place, where he consistently delivered strong sales performance and built long-term client partnerships.
In his new role, Himanshu will lead the MICE vertical at Holiday Inn New Delhi Mayur Vihar Noida, focusing on driving group business, maximizing banquet and event revenues, and strengthening the hotel’s position in the competitive MICE market.
A graduate in Hotel Management from IILM College, Gurgaon, Himanshu is currently pursuing his MBA from IMT Ghaziabad, further enhancing his leadership and strategic acumen. Outside work, he enjoys fitness, snooker, yoga, and reading.
Speaking on the appointment, N. Vinaayak, Director of Sales & Marketing, said, “We are delighted to have Himanshu as part of our team. His passion, expertise, and leadership will be instrumental in driving Catering Sales to new heights.”
Anurag Rai, General Manager, added, “Himanshu’s appointment marks an exciting chapter as we strengthen our MICE offerings. His strategic approach and guest-centric mindset align perfectly with our vision of delivering exceptional experiences.”

BarNaan Brookfield, a dynamic destination for authentic and modern Indian dining, has appointed Chef Kailash Singh as its new Sous Chef. With international experience and a deep-rooted passion for Indian cuisine, Chef Kailash is set to bring creativity, precision, and contemporary flair to the restaurant’s culinary offerings.
Most recently, he served as Chef de Partie at ROOH San Francisco, refining his expertise in progressive Indian cuisine. His international journey also includes creating Indian-inspired menus in Warsaw, Poland, and specializing in tandoor-based dishes at Namak by Chef Kunal Kapoor, Dusit Thani Abu Dhabi.
Chef Kailash’s earlier career spans prestigious Indian and Middle Eastern dining destinations, including Oven Hot Bakery & Sweets L.L.C Abu Dhabi, Masala Library by Jiggs Kalra, Café Out of the Box (Khan Market), Trinity Residency (Gurgaon), and Mojo Blu (Cyber Green). He has also contributed to several pre-opening projects, focusing on kitchen setup, menu development, and team training.
Speaking about his new role, Chef Kailash Singh said, “Joining BarNaan Brookfield is a significant milestone in my career. I am excited to contribute to the restaurant’s vision and look forward to creating new dishes that celebrate Indian flavors with a modern twist.”
With Chef Kailash on board, BarNaan Brookfield continues to position itself as a premier destination for Indian fine dining in the US, offering guests memorable experiences that blend authenticity, innovation, and world-class hospitality.
Namak Indian Restaurant & Bar, a premier destination for authentic Indian dining in Dallas, has announced the appointment of Chef Saurabh Sharma Sarswat as its new Executive Sous Chef. Bringing years of global culinary experience across luxury hotels, fine dining restaurants, and private kitchens, Chef Sarswat is set to elevate the restaurant’s offerings with his expertise in Indian cuisine.
Chef Sarswat’s journey spans multiple countries and prestigious establishments. Most recently, he served as Sous Chef at Sanjh Restaurant – Las Colinas, Dallas, overseeing daily kitchen operations, menu execution, and maintaining top-quality standards. He also contributed to menu planning and kitchen management at Rixos Premium Hotel in Antalya, Turkey, and served as Personal Head Chef to Shaikh Azzam Al Mannai at a private resort in Doha, Qatar, creating Indian and Pakistani dishes for exclusive events.
His international experience further includes working with OYO Hotels across China, Japan, and Hong Kong as Sous Chef (Indian cuisine), specializing in menu development, banquet catering, and tandoor preparations. Earlier in India, Chef Sarswat honed his skills at AnnaMaya at Andaz (Hyatt), Eros Hotel New Delhi, Courtyard by Marriott Gurugram, and Jaypee Siddharth New Delhi, gaining a deep understanding of Indian ingredients, spices, and cooking techniques.
Speaking about his new role, Chef Sarswat said, “Joining Namak Indian Restaurant & Bar is an exciting chapter in my journey. I look forward to bringing my experience and creativity to Dallas’s vibrant food scene and sharing the richness of Indian cuisine with our guests.”
With Chef Sarswat on board, Namak Indian Restaurant & Bar continues to offer authentic Indian flavors with a contemporary twist, further establishing itself as Dallas’s go-to destination for fine Indian dining.
